Key Elements of a Dating Profile: Photos

When it comes to dating profiles, photos are often the first thing people notice, and they play a crucial role in forming initial impressions. Choosing the right photos can be the difference between a swipe left and a potential connection. The key is to select a variety of photos that showcase your personality, interests, and lifestyle. Avoid using only selfies, as they can sometimes come across as narcissistic or lacking in depth. Instead, opt for photos that capture you in different settings and situations, such as engaging in hobbies, spending time with friends, or exploring new places. These types of photos can provide a more well-rounded view of who you are and what you're passionate about.

It's also important to ensure that your photos are clear, well-lit, and recent. Outdated or blurry photos can be misleading and may give the impression that you're trying to hide something. A friendly smile and genuine expression can go a long way in making you appear approachable and likable. Additionally, consider the overall message your photos are sending. Are they projecting confidence, warmth, and authenticity? Do they align with the type of person you're hoping to attract? Key Elements of a Dating Profile: Bio and Written Content

While photos grab attention, the bio and written content of a dating profile are what truly allow you to showcase your personality, values, and interests. This is your opportunity to communicate who you are beyond your appearance and to articulate what you're looking for in a partner. A well-crafted bio can be the deciding factor for someone who is on the fence after seeing your photos. It's crucial to avoid generic phrases and clichés, such as "I love to travel" or "I'm just looking for someone to have fun with." Instead, strive to be specific and authentic, highlighting what makes you unique and what truly matters to you.

Share your passions, hobbies, and interests in a way that is engaging and informative. What are you genuinely excited about? What activities do you enjoy in your free time? What are your goals and aspirations? By providing concrete details, you give potential matches something to connect with and spark a conversation. It's also important to convey your sense of humor and personality in your writing. A touch of wit or a playful tone can make your profile more memorable and approachable. However, be mindful of the tone you're setting and ensure it aligns with your personality and the type of relationship you're seeking. Finally, be clear about what you're looking for in a partner. Are you seeking a long-term relationship, casual dating, or something else? Honesty and transparency are key to attracting the right type of connection.
